Contact/ Call centre AdvisorEdinburgh6 months£12.22 per hour PAYEMy high-profile banking client are recruiting for multiple Contact/ Call centre advisor. The role is a Hybrid role which will require the candidate to work on site 3 days a week and 2 days from home, working normal office hours 9-5. The role will be for a 12-month contracting position.
